Balancing Warm and Cool: Creating Harmony in Your Home

Finding the right mix of warm and cool colors is crucial for a beautiful home. Adding cool accents to your warm colors makes your space welcoming and stylish.

Cool Accents to Complement Warm Tones

Think of your warm colors as the base. Then, add cool elements to create a stunning contrast. Here are some ideas:

  • Use gray-toned neutrals to balance rich reds or earthy browns.
  • Add blue-hued accessories to cool down sunny yellows or vibrant oranges.
  • Bring in metallic finishes like silver or steel for a cool touch in cozy areas.

Mixing and Matching: Finding the Perfect Blend

Try out different color mixes to create harmony in your home. First, find your main warm colors. Then, think about how to balance warm and cool in your space. Look at the undertones of your colors and how they work together.

Warm ToneComplementary Cool Accent
TerracottaSoft blue
Mustard yellowSage green
BurgundyCharcoal gray

By balancing warm and cool colors, you can make a design that’s both cohesive and engaging. It will show off your style and make your home cozy and inviting.

Warm Lighting: Enhancing the Cozy Ambiance

Warm lighting makes your home feel cozy and inviting. It changes any space into a place of comfort and relaxation. By choosing the right lighting, you can make your home feel welcoming.

Choosing the right light bulbs is key. Look for bulbs with a lower Kelvin temperature for a softer glow. Warm LED bulbs or incandescent bulbs work well. Also, dimmable lights let you adjust the brightness to match your mood.

Placing lamps and sconces wisely adds to the cozy feel. Choose fixtures with shades to soften the light. This is great for living rooms, bedrooms, and areas where you relax.

Candles also add warmth and coziness. The flickering flames create a serene and intimate feel. Place candles on side tables, mantles, or in the bathroom for a cozy vibe.

Creating a cozy ambiance with warm lighting is all about balance. Try different lighting setups and adjust the brightness and placement. This will help you find the perfect warmth and comfort in your home.

Seasonal Shifts: Embracing Warm Colors Year-Round

As the seasons change, we often want our homes to feel cozier. Warm colors can make our homes welcoming all year. By using warm colors year-round and seasonal decor, we can easily change our home’s look with the seasons. This keeps our home warm and inviting.

Finding the right mix of warm colors is key. Whether it’s autumn’s earthy tones or summer’s bright colors, we can match them to any season. Adding different textures and patterns helps create a cozy and inviting space that changes with the weather.

  • Autumn: Embrace the cozy appeal of deep reds, burnt oranges, and golden yellows to create a harvest-inspired ambiance.
  • Winter: Incorporate warm neutrals like beige, tan, and camel to offset the cool, crisp tones of the season.
  • Spring: Energize your space with pops of cheerful peach, coral, and terracotta to welcome the blooming outdoors.
  • Summer: Bask in the warmth of vibrant yellows, vibrant reds, and earthy browns for a sun-drenched, laid-back vibe.

By using warm colors year-round and seasonal decor, our homes stay cozy and familiar. These colors help us create a welcoming space. Let them guide you in making a cozy home that you’ll love all year.
